Abstract

Nowadays, power demand is increasing day by day and also ageing of the networks makes the system difficult for power flow control through the transmission lines. The voltage variation in transmission line should be limited which is due to the load changes; these problems are solved by using FACTS devices. A new device has been introduced called distributed power flow converter (DPFC), where distributed FACTS concept is utilized and common DC-link has been removed as present in the UPFC, and transmission line is used for the exchange of real powers between shunt and series converters. In this paper proposed carrier-less hysteresis band control (HBC) method has been used for controlling the pulses in series and shunt converters individually. The DPFC has same controllability as of the UPFC; a DPFC requires multiple numbers of one-phase series converters in place of a three-phase series converter of large rating. DPFC with single-phase series converters reduces cost and increasing reliability of the power; the whole research is implemented in MATLAB/SIMULINK.
